Before working with a locksmith, it's important to ask a couple of concerns to guarantee they are the best suitable for your requirements:
QuestionFunctionAre you accredited and guaranteed?To guarantee they are a genuine organization.What services do you use?To validate they have the specific service needed.What are your rates?To prevent any surprise charges later on.The length of time will it require to reach my place?To evaluate their response time.Do you supply estimates before starting work?To understand the expected expenses upfront.The Cost of Hiring a Car LocksmithUnderstanding the possible expenses related to hiring a locksmith can assist you budget plan accordingly. Common aspects that affect rates consist of:
ServiceAverage Cost RangeLockout service₤ 50 - ₤ 150Key replacement₤ 75 - ₤ 250Ignition repair₤ 100 - ₤ 300Secret fob programming₤ 80 - ₤ 300Emergency situation servicesAdditional fees may applyNote:
The prices can vary based upon place, lorry type, and the time of service (emergency calls may incur additional charges).
Tips for Preventing Lockouts and Key IssuesAvoidance is always much better than remedy. Here are some proactive pointers to avoid lockouts and other key-related problems:
Keep a Spare Key: Store an extra key in a surprise however accessible place or provide one to a trusted friend or member of the family.
Use a Keychain Tracker: Consider purchasing a Bluetooth key tracker that can alert you to your keys' area.
Regular Key Maintenance: Regularly inspect your keys for indications of wear and change them if they show damage.
Test Locks and Ignition: Periodically inspect to guarantee your locks and ignition systems function appropriately.
Stay Alert: Always double-check before leaving your car to avoid leaving secrets within.

Q: How long does it take for a locksmith to unlock my car?A: Typically, a locksmith can unlock a standard car in 10-30 minutes, depending upon the circumstance and type of lock.
Q: Can locksmith professionals deal with modern cars?A: Yes, lots of expert locksmith professionals are trained and geared up to manage contemporary lorries, including electronic locks and key fobs.
Q: What if my car has a transponder secret?A: A certified locksmith can configure transponder secrets, but it's important to confirm that they have the best devices and experience for your particular lorry design.
